Covid-19 roundup: Eu­rope to seek clar­i­fi­ca­tion on Pfiz­er/BioN­Tech de­lays; J&J pre­dicts 100M dos­es for US by April

With re­ports over slowed dis­tri­b­u­tion of the Pfiz­er/BioN­Tech vac­cine and threats of law­suits dan­gling, the Eu­ro­pean Com­mis­sion is plan­ning to ask the com­pa­ny for a clar­i­fi­ca­tion over de­liv­ery time­lines.

A spokesman for the EU’s ex­ec­u­tive branch made the com­ments ear­ly Fri­day, ac­cord­ing to a Reuters re­port. Pfiz­er and the Com­mis­sion had ear­li­er said that there would be no more slow­downs next week as it con­tin­ues to al­ter a man­u­fac­tur­ing site in Bel­gium to ramp up pro­duc­tion.
